浏览器调试模式下点击事件失效?轻松解决!
网页调试过程中,开发者工具(F12)常常导致页面元素点击事件失效,例如下拉菜单无法点击选择。这严重影响调试效率。本文提供几种排查及解决方法:
问题原因分析:
开发者工具本身可能干扰页面渲染或事件触发。几种常见原因:
断点或代码修改: 调试过程中设置的断点或对相关代码的修改,可能阻碍事件正常执行。 建议移除断点或恢复代码至原始状态。
开发者工具辅助功能: 元素高亮等功能可能意外覆盖或阻止事件触发。尝试关闭不必要的辅助功能。
浏览器或扩展程序兼容性问题: 浏览器版本或安装的扩展程序可能与开发者工具冲突。建议尝试不同浏览器或禁用部分扩展程序。
网页代码问题: 下拉框相关的JavaScript代码可能存在错误或逻辑问题。 检查控制台日志(console)查找错误信息,并检查事件监听器绑定及事件处理函数是否正常运行。
解决步骤:
移除断点并恢复代码: 检查并移除所有设置的断点,将修改的代码恢复原状。
关闭开发者工具辅助功能: 关闭元素高亮、缩放等辅助功能。
尝试不同浏览器或禁用扩展程序: 在其他浏览器中尝试复现问题,或禁用可疑的浏览器扩展程序。
检查JavaScript代码: 仔细检查下拉框相关代码,特别是事件监听器(addEventListener)的绑定是否正确,以及事件处理函数是否正常工作。 查看控制台日志(console)寻找错误提示。
通过以上步骤,通常可以有效解决浏览器调试模式下点击事件失效的问题,确保调试工作的顺利进行。
以上就是浏览器调试模式下点击事件失效了怎么办?的详细内容,更多请关注软件指南其它相关文章!
本文来自互联网或AI生成,不代表软件指南立场。本站不负任何法律责任。
如若转载请注明出处:http://www.down96.com/tutorials/282.html